#cd5007 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d5007 is composed of 80.4% red, 31.4%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 22.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 41.6%. #cd5007 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a00e with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#cd5007 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d5007 has RGB values of R:205, G:80,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.97,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13455367.

Shades and Tints of #cd5007
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d5007
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6a69 is the less saturated color, while #cd5007 is the most saturated one.
